Usage & contexts

Examples

  • The balloon is deflated (气球瘪了).
  • He looks thin and shrunken (他看起来很干瘪).
  • The tire went flat (轮胎瘪了).
  • The wallet is empty (钱包瘪了).

Cultural background

FAQ
  • Often used to describe objects that have lost their fullness or air.
  • In Shanghainese slang, '瘪三' refers to a beggar or a poor, wretched person.
  • Can carry a negative connotation when describing a person's physical state or financial situation.
